Units
1.The
Research and Studies Unit: This unit conducts research, studies
and reports on the status of human rights, and the laws governing
them. The researchers of this unit also formulate programs aimed at
disseminating and introducing the general principles of human rights
and freedoms, in addition to creating activity projects for the programs
from the workshops, courses and seminars.
2. The Information Unit: This unit provides the referential
databases concerning issues related to human rights and freedoms,
and to the organizations working in these fields in the Arab world
in general, and Jordan in particular. This unit documents and classifies
the information obtained from the specialized periodicals, the working
papers presented during the relevant conferences and seminars, and
the bulletins and reports issued by the local, Arab and international
organizations. The unit's database is a referential source for human
rights activists, and concerned civil society organizations, academicians
and researchers.
3. The Electronic Publication Unit (The Internet): This unit
aims to reach the largest number of entities concerned with human
rights issues, by publishing the activities, publications and future
work-plans of the Human Rights Program, in addition to publishing
summaries of the working papers presented during these activities,
and the researches, studies and reports prepared by the Program researchers.
